I installed version 102.0.1 of Thunderbird (Windows 10) and wanted to use the same add-ons I've been using. They were all reported as not compatible (TbSync, Provider for CalDAV, Provider for Exchange ActiveSync). What are my options? Will they work despite the non-compatible notice? Should I roll back to version 91? To do that, can I simply uninstall version 102 and I'll have my old version there?

I think this may work: - exit TB click windows key and 'r' key at same time and then in new window

  enter "thunderbird.exe -p --allow-downgrade  "
